SQL Server索引重建和重新组织脚本


  为了有针对性的重建索引,提高数据库的效能,同时避免因全部重建造成服务器的Loading,我们内部有开发一个存储过程脚本,逻辑大概如下:

     首先遍历该实例中所有数据库中所有table中的index,并将Fragment保存到临时表中,这当中用到了一个系统存储过程:sp_MSforeachdb 可以实现对所有数据库的循环遍历;然后对临时表中的数据进行处理,如果

碎片介于20%--40%,则对索引进行重新组织,大于40%则进行重建。

USE [msdb]
GO
/****** Object:  StoredProcedure [dbo].[IndexMaintain]    Script Date: 09/14/2012 17:59:33 ******/
SET ANSI_NULLS ON
GO
SET QUOTED_IDENTIFIER ON
GO
 -- =============================================
-- Author
-- Create date:  2012/01/17
-- Description:    IndexMaintain
-- ==============================================
ALTER  procedure  [dbo].[IndexMaintain]  
as   
SET NOCOUNT on 
 
BEGIN TRY 
    declare @EXCEPTION VARCHAR(MAX)
    declare @MailSubject NVARCHAR(255)
    declare @DBName NVARCHAR(255)
    declare @TableName NVARCHAR(255)
    declare @SchemaName NVARCHAR(255)
    declare @IndexName NVARCHAR(255)
    declare @avg_fragmentation_in_percent_old DECIMAL(18,3)
    declare @avg_page_space_used_in_percent_old DECIMAL(18,3)
    declare @avg_fragmentation_in_percent_new DECIMAL(18,3)
    declare @avg_page_space_used_in_percent_new DECIMAL(18,3)
            
    declare @Defrag NVARCHAR(max)
    declare @Sql NVARCHAR(max)
    declare @ParmDefinition nvarchar(500)
    set @EXCEPTION=''
    
    --删除#Frag
    if exists(select *  from sys.objects where object_id=object_id(N'#Frag'))
    drop table #Frag 
       
    --定义临时表#Frag保存index Fragment    
    create table #Frag(
                 DBname  NVARCHAR(255),
                 TableName NVARCHAR(255),
                 SchemaName NVARCHAR(255),
                 IndexName NVARCHAR(255),
                 AvgFragment DECIMAL(18,3),
                 avg_page_space_used DECIMAL(18,3)
                 )
                 
    --遍历DB中所有table上的index,并将Fragment保存到临时表#Frag中.
    exec sp_MSforeachdb @command1= 'insert into #Frag(DBname, TableName,SchemaName,IndexName,AvgFragment,avg_page_space_used)
                                    select ''[?]'' AS DBName, t.Name AS TableName, sc.Name AS SchemaName, i.name AS IndexName, s.avg_fragmentation_in_percent, s.avg_page_space_used_in_percent  
                                    from [?].sys.dm_db_index_physical_stats(DB_ID(''?''),NULL,NULL,NULL,''Sampled'') AS s
                                    join [?].sys.indexes i on s.Object_Id=i.Object_id and s.Index_id=i.Index_id
                                    join [?].sys.tables t on i.Object_id=t.Object_ID 
                                    join [?].sys.schemas sc on t.schema_id=sc.SCHEMA_ID
                                    where s.avg_fragmentation_in_percent  >20 and t.type=''U'' and s.page_count>8 and i.allow_page_locks=1 and i.allow_row_locks=1 
                                    order by  TableName,IndexName '

    --定义CURSOR遍历临时表#Frag,根据Fragment大小采取不同的方案维护index.
    declare cList CURSOR for
            select *  from #Frag 
    open cList 
    fetch next from cList into @DBName,@TableName,@SchemaName,@IndexName,@avg_fragmentation_in_percent_old,@avg_page_space_used_in_percent_old
    while @@FETCH_STATUS=0
    begin 
       set @TableName ='['+ @TableName +']'
       --Fragment between 20.0 and 40.0 ,使用 Alter INDEX reorganize整理碎片
       if @avg_fragmentation_in_percent_old between 20.0 and 40.0 AND @DBName <>'[TOPCOA]' 
       begin          
         --整理碎片
         set @Defrag=N'Alter INDEX   '+''+@IndexName+' on '+@DBName+'.'+@SchemaName+'.'+@TableName+' reorganize'
         exec sp_executesql @Defrag
                  
         --获取index被整理后的碎片比例
         set @Sql=N'USE '+@DBName+'; select @avg_fragmentation_in_percent_new_temp=s.avg_fragmentation_in_percent,@avg_page_space_used_in_percent_new_temp= s.avg_page_space_used_in_percent 
                    from  '+@DBName+'.sys.indexes i  
                    inner join '+@DBName+'.sys.dm_db_index_physical_stats(db_id(replace(replace('''+@DBName+''',''['',''''),'']'','''')), object_id('''+@TableName+''''+'),null,null,''sampled'') as s on   i.index_id=s.index_id  
                    where i.object_id=object_id('''+@TableName+''''+')and i.name='''+@IndexName+''''
         set @ParmDefinition=N'@avg_fragmentation_in_percent_new_temp  DECIMAL(18,3) output,@avg_page_space_used_in_percent_new_temp DECIMAL(18,3) output'
         exec sp_executesql @Sql,@ParmDefinition ,@avg_fragmentation_in_percent_new_temp=@avg_fragmentation_in_percent_new output, @avg_page_space_used_in_percent_new_temp=@avg_page_space_used_in_percent_new output
         
         --write log
         insert [dbo].IndexDefrag values(@DBName,@TableName,@SchemaName,@IndexName,getdate(),@avg_fragmentation_in_percent_old,@avg_page_space_used_in_percent_old,@avg_fragmentation_in_percent_new,@avg_page_space_used_in_percent_new,'0')
       end 
        --Fragment大于40.0 ,使用 Alter INDEX rebuild整理碎片
       else if @avg_fragmentation_in_percent_old >40.0 AND @DBName <>'[TOPCOA]'
       begin          
         --整理碎片 
         set @Defrag=N'Alter INDEX    '+''+@IndexName+' on '+@DBName+'.'+@SchemaName+'.'+@TableName+' rebuild'
         exec sp_executesql @Defrag 
         
         --获取index被整理后的碎片比例
         set @Sql=N'USE '+@DBName+';select @avg_fragmentation_in_percent_new_temp=s.avg_fragmentation_in_percent,@avg_page_space_used_in_percent_new_temp= s.avg_page_space_used_in_percent 
                    from  '+@DBName+'.sys.indexes i  
                    inner join '+@DBName+'.sys.dm_db_index_physical_stats(db_id(replace(replace('''+@DBName+''',''['',''''),'']'','''')), object_id('''+@TableName+''''+'),null,null,''sampled'') as s on   i.index_id=s.index_id  
                    where i.object_id=object_id('''+@TableName+''''+')and i.name='''+@IndexName+''''
         set @ParmDefinition=N'@avg_fragmentation_in_percent_new_temp  DECIMAL(18,3) output,@avg_page_space_used_in_percent_new_temp DECIMAL(18,3) output'
         exec sp_executesql @Sql,@ParmDefinition ,@avg_fragmentation_in_percent_new_temp=@avg_fragmentation_in_percent_new output, @avg_page_space_used_in_percent_new_temp=@avg_page_space_used_in_percent_new output
         
         --write log
         insert [dbo].IndexDefrag values(@DBName,@TableName,@SchemaName,@IndexName,getdate(),@avg_fragmentation_in_percent_old,@avg_page_space_used_in_percent_old,@avg_fragmentation_in_percent_new,@avg_page_space_used_in_percent_new,'1')
        end 
      fetch next from cList into @DBName,@TableName,@SchemaName,@IndexName,@avg_fragmentation_in_percent_old,@avg_page_space_used_in_percent_old
    end 
    close cList 
    deallocate cList 
END TRY
BEGIN CATCH
    SET @EXCEPTION = ERROR_MESSAGE() 
END CATCH

IF @EXCEPTION<>''
BEGIN 
    SET @MailSubject='[Important]DB Index Maintainence failed from ' + @@SERVERNAME  
    EXEC msdb.dbo.sp_send_dbmail
    @profile_name = 'mail',                     
    @recipients = 'xxxxxx@xxx.com',
    @body = @EXCEPTION, 
    @subject = @MailSubject 
    
END
